What is Gambling Addiction?

Gambling addiction, also known as compulsive gambling, is a behavioral disorder where individuals feel an uncontrollable urge to gamble despite the negative consequences it may bring. This addiction can severely impact one’s personal relationships, financial stability, and mental health. Unlike occasional gamblers, those with a gambling addiction often prioritize their gambling activities above everything else, leading to a cycle of loss and desperation. The thrill of gambling can become a powerful motivation, overshadowing any rational thoughts about the risks involved. As the addiction deepens, individuals may find themselves chasing losses, which only exacerbates their financial and emotional turmoil. Understanding this addiction is crucial for recognizing its symptoms and seeking timely help.

Recognizing the Warning Signs

Recognizing gambling addiction starts with identifying specific behavioral patterns. Common warning signs include spending excessive time and money on gambling, neglecting responsibilities, and experiencing mood swings when not gambling. Individuals may also lie about their gambling habits, hide their activities, or even resort to theft to fund their addiction.

The Impact of Gambling Addiction

The consequences of gambling addiction extend far beyond financial loss. Relationships often suffer as trust erodes and communication breaks down. Family members may feel betrayed or hurt, leading to significant emotional distress within the household. Furthermore, the mental health impacts can be profound, resulting in anxiety disorders, depression, and even suicidal thoughts.

Seeking Help for Gambling Addiction

Seeking help is a vital step in overcoming gambling addiction. There are numerous resources available, including therapy, support groups, and hotlines specifically designed to assist those struggling with this addiction.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) is often effective in helping individuals change their thought patterns related to gambling.
